Author Details
"Todd Montgomery" has been in the networking industry for more than 35 years and holds many certifications from CompTIA, Cisco, Juniper, VMware, and other companies. He is CompTIA Cloud+, Network+, and Security+ certified.

"Stephen Olson" has been in the networking industry for almost 15 years and holds many certifications including Cisco’s CCIE #21910, the Cisco CCNA, and CCNP, among others. Steve has spent the majority of his career working in large enterprises as well as consulting for service providers around the world in the cloud, WAN, and data center segments.
